Explanation
Statement 1 is correct: Rajya Sabha is a permanent chamber of the Parliament and is not subject to dissolution. It ensures continuity of the legislature. Statement 2 is correct: When the Lok Sabha is dissolved, the Rajya Sabha remains in existence. A session or meeting of the Rajya Sabha can be called to address urgent matters or to approve crucial proclamations (such as a proclamation of Emergency) during the period when the Lok Sabha is dissolved.
